本文目录导读:
随着互联网技术的飞速发展,网站开发已经成为众多企业和个人必备的技能,Visual Studio(简称VS)作为一款功能强大的集成开发环境,在网站开发领域具有广泛的应用,本文将深入剖析VS网站开发源码,并结合实战技巧,为大家提供一套完整的网站开发解决方案。
VS网站开发概述
1、VS简介
Visual Studio是由微软公司开发的一款集成开发环境,广泛应用于软件开发、网站开发、移动应用开发等领域,VS拥有丰富的功能,包括代码编辑、调试、项目管理、版本控制等,为开发者提供了便捷的开发体验。
图片来源于网络,如有侵权联系删除
2、VS网站开发优势
(1)强大的开发工具:VS提供了丰富的开发工具,如ASP.NET、C#、HTML、CSS、JavaScript等,满足不同类型网站的开发需求。
(2)高效的开发效率:VS具有代码提示、智能感知、自动完成等功能,大大提高了开发效率。
(3)良好的社区支持:VS拥有庞大的开发者社区,为开发者提供了丰富的学习资源和解决方案。
VS网站开发源码剖析
1、ASP.NET源码解析
ASP.NET是微软推出的一种用于构建动态网站的框架,其源码主要由C#语言编写,以下是对ASP.NET源码的简要解析:
(1)ASP.NET核心组件:ASP.NET核心组件包括HTTP请求处理、应用程序管理、配置管理等,负责处理用户请求和应用程序管理。
(2)ASP.NET MVC:ASP.NET MVC是一种流行的Web开发模式,其源码主要由C#语言编写,MVC模式将Web应用程序分为模型(Model)、视图(View)和控制器(Controller)三个部分,实现了视图与业务逻辑的分离。
图片来源于网络,如有侵权联系删除
(3)ASP.NET Web API:ASP.NET Web API是一种用于构建RESTful服务的框架,其源码主要由C#语言编写,Web API可以方便地实现跨平台开发,支持多种编程语言和协议。
2、HTML、CSS、JavaScript源码解析
(1)HTML:HTML是超文本标记语言,用于创建网页的基本结构,HTML源码主要由标签组成,通过标签定义网页元素、布局和样式。
(2)CSS:CSS是层叠样式表,用于控制网页元素的样式,CSS源码主要由选择器和属性组成,通过选择器选择页面元素,并设置相应的属性。
(3)JavaScript:JavaScript是一种客户端脚本语言,用于实现网页的交互功能,JavaScript源码主要由函数、对象和事件处理程序组成,通过函数实现逻辑处理,对象存储数据,事件处理程序响应用户操作。
VS网站开发实战技巧
1、代码规范
(1)命名规范:遵循PascalCase或camelCase命名规范,提高代码可读性。
(2)代码注释:对关键代码进行注释,便于后期维护。
图片来源于网络,如有侵权联系删除
2、优化性能
(1)合理使用缓存:利用缓存技术减少数据库访问次数,提高页面加载速度。
(2)压缩资源:对CSS、JavaScript、HTML等资源进行压缩,减少文件体积。
3、版本控制
(1)使用Git进行版本控制,便于代码管理和团队协作。
(2)遵循代码审查规范,确保代码质量。
本文深入剖析了VS网站开发源码,并结合实战技巧,为开发者提供了一套完整的网站开发解决方案,通过学习本文,开发者可以更好地掌握VS网站开发,提高开发效率,为企业和个人创造更多价值。
标签: #vs网站开发源码
评论列表